Principal Jobs in Maryland

A Principal in elementary education serves as the leader and manager for the school, setting its educational standards and goals, and ensuring it meets them. They are responsible for creating a safe and productive learning environment, managing teaching staff, overseeing curriculum, and communicating with parents and community members. They also handle the school's administrative duties, such as budgeting and scheduling. A Principal is expected to have a deep understanding of elementary education, curriculum development, and school administration. In addition, they should possess excellent leadership, communication, problem-solving, and decision-making skills.

To become a Principal, an individual typically needs a master's degree in Education Administration or a related field, and some states may also require completion of a school administrator licensing program. Prior to becoming a Principal, they often have experience as a teacher or school counselor, gaining firsthand classroom experience and understanding of student needs. Some may also have roles as an Assistant Principal or a Department Head, managing aspects of school administration and gaining leadership experience. These roles provide the necessary professional experience and knowledge needed to effectively run a school.
